they were ahead of their time, the founders read a lot, and Madison read about government before he framed the blueprint for the Constitution months before the Constitutional convention, and he asked himself the question "why do governments fail"
because they turn tyrannical in the end.
a king becomes a dictator
rule of the few becomes an oligarchy
rule by all, becomes mob rule
our founders sought to solve this problem by incorporating all three governments into American government
monarchy aristocracy, and democracy.
which when there are three different types of government within American government, tyranny cannot take place because each has power to prevent the takeover of the other.
